Internet Service

Internet service is provided through a connection to the Bridgewater State College Network. A high-speed data line connects the college backbone to the outside world. This service provides a faster connection to the Internet than a modem. It allows access to popular tools like the World Wide Web, FTP, e-mail and more.

System Requirements

To recieve full support from the ResNet staff, computers must meet the following specifications:

  • Processor: 1.0 Ghz
  • Memory: 256 MB
  • Hard Drive: 20 GB
  • External Ports: USB, VGA
  • Operating System*: Microsoft Windows 2000 Pro (w/Service Pack 4)
  • Network Adapter: 10/100 Ethernet
  • State: The computer must be self-booting

All computers not meeting this standard, or having a different Operating System (*including Mac OS or Linux) will receive 1 hour of ResNet support provided that the computer self-boots. If the computer does not self-boot or ResNet staff has worked on the computer for one hour, users will need to get assistance from a commercial repair facility, such as those listed below.
